Day 3 Drive to Panajachel (2½hrs) on the shores of LakeAtitlán. Day 4 Relax and enjoy the lake’s panoramic views. Day 5 Driveto the atmospheric Mayan town of Chichicastenango, still an importantcentre for trading and religious ceremonies. Day 6 Spend time at theworld-famous produce and artisan market; return to Antigua. Days 7&8Fly to Flores, and stay in a simple jungle lodge well located for exploringthe Mayan ruins at Tikal within dense rainforest. Days 9-11 A 3-hourdrive across the border into <strong>Belize</strong>. Spend 3 nights at the rural Lodge atChaa Creek beside the Macal River, where you can ride to the ruins atXunantunich on horse-back or kayak to the nearby town of San Ignacio.Days 12-14 Drive to <strong>Belize</strong> City, and fly to Ambergris Caye, (20 mins) acoral island offering diving and snorkelling. Unwind at the whitewashedVictoria House resort (p30) overlooking the Caribbean Sea.Day 15 Fly to <strong>Belize</strong> City arriving in the UK on day 16.Above: Tikal has the tallest pyramids in the Mayan world (64m). Toucans, trogons, tinamous, woodpeckers,hawks and hummingbirds, to name but a few of the numerous species you may well spot.CHARLIE DOGGETT / ISTOCKPHOTO.COMDAVID PLUMMERCity of TikalDaily from Flores3 days, 2 nightsFrom £133pp based on two sharingDrive to the vast Mayan City Tikal,where a network of steep sky-scraperpyramids pierce the remote forestcanopy. If you rise at dawn, you willexperience the tropical jungle fi llingwith the agitated scream of parakeetsand the haunting roar of howlermonkeys. This is one of the mostatmospheric of all the mist-shroudedcities of the Maya.
